Richard Sherman Career Stats
Richard Sherman is an American football cornerback who has played in the National Football League (NFL) for 11 seasons. He has played for the Seattle Seahawks, San Francisco 49ers, and Tampa Bay Buccaneers.
Sherman is one of the most successful cornerbacks in NFL history. He has been named to the Pro Bowl five times and the All-Pro team four times. He was also named the NFL Defensive Player of the Year in 2013.
Sherman has recorded 48 interceptions, 110 pass deflections, and 9 forced fumbles in his career. He has also scored 3 touchdowns.

| Name | Birth Date | Birth Place | Height | Weight |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Richard Sherman | March 30, 1988 | Compton, California | 6'3" | 200 lbs |
